Company Description Pichi Richi Railway Preservation Society Inc. is a volunteer-run heritage railway operating between Quorn and Port Augusta on sections of the original Ghan line in South Australia. Established in 1973, the Society has grown into a recognized tourism operator, earning Silver in the 2023 South Australian Tourism Awards.
n
We operate steam and diesel trains from March to November. Maintenance, restoration, and planning activities occur year-round, supporting safe and memorable experiences for visitors to the Flinders Ranges region.
